Portability
The Fisherfans Gimbal Stabilizer weighs only 0.49 lb and measures just 7.5 inches when folded, making it highly portable. Its extendable aluminum alloy rod reaches 31.5 inches, allowing users to capture wide shots effortlessly. The Octo Mount, designed for on-the-go use, is lightweight enough to fit in a backpack or purse. While both products prioritize portability, the Fisherfans model provides a longer reach, which may be beneficial for capturing group photos or expansive scenery.
Compatibility
Compatibility is a strong point for both stabilizers. The Fisherfans model features a flexible phone holder that accommodates most smartphones between 4.0-6.2 inches and can also adapt to GoPro cameras with a 1/4 connector. The Octo Mount is compatible with a variety of devices, including popular smartphones like iPhones and Samsung Galaxy models. This universality makes both products appealing, though the Fisherfans offers slightly more advanced adaptability for different types of cameras.
Ease of Use
The Fisherfans Gimbal Stabilizer is designed for intuitive operation, allowing users to switch between horizontal and vertical modes with a simple press. The inclusion of a wireless remote control enhances the ease of use, enabling users to capture selfies or group photos from up to 32 feet away. In comparison, the Octo Mount also emphasizes ease of use, with its universal phone clamp that allows for secure holding and easy switching between portrait and landscape views. While both products are user-friendly, the Fisherfans model provides more advanced features that may appeal to those looking for enhanced functionality.
